The performance of the top five virtual pet applications in Tunisia during the first quarter of 2022 exhibited diverse tr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active user numbers. Here’s a closer look at how each app performed.
Talking Tom Cat 2 for iPad from Outfit7 Limited saw a steady weekly revenue of around $5 to $6. The app's weekly downloads increased significantly from 1.6K at the start of January to nearly 3.8K by the end of March. Weekly active users also climbed from 7.5K to approximately 11K over the quarter.
My Talking Tom, another app by Outfit7 Limited, had a stable weekly revenue, mostly around $3 to $5. Weekly downloads fluctuated, peaking at around 5.9K in mid-January and maintaining a similar level towards the end of the quarter. The app had a high number of weekly active users, starting at 60K and ending at around 57K.
My Talking Angela showed consistent weekly revenue of around $4. Weekly downloads ranged between 4.3K and 5.6K, with a notable increase towards the end of the quarter. The app’s weekly active users remained strong, starting at 95K and slightly decreasing to about 89K by the end of March.
Towniz: Hatch Eggs & Grow Pets by My Town Games LTD experienced minimal revenue. Weekly downloads were low, starting at 132 and slightly fluctuating, ending at 131. The app's weekly active users remained relatively constant around 400 throughout the quarter.
My Talking Angela 2, also from Outfit7 Limited, had inconsistent revenue, peaking at $11 in early February. Weekly downloads varied, beginning at 2.5K and reaching around 4.5K by the end of March. The app showed a steady increase in weekly active users, starting at 31K and rising to nearly 39K.
